Overview

The Reno Amtrak Station is a historic train station located in downtown Reno. It is a stop on the famous California Zephyr route, which runs between Chicago and the San Francisco Bay Area. The station is uniquely situated in a trench, known as the ReTRAC, which lowered the tracks below street level to improve traffic flow.
